comparemela.com

Top Locations Tagged with Sams Anchor Cafe Webcam

Sams Anchor Cafe Webcam in United States - 94920/Restaurant near Marin

1). Sam's Anchor Cafe

2). Sam's Anchor Cafe, Main St

vimarsana © 2020. All Rights Reserved.